T-Shirt Bag






So, my husband was cleaning out the closet and had a few old T's he didn't want anymore so I quickly snagged them up and attempted the T-shirt Bag! I think it turned out pretty cool! Its super easy, no sewing required and fun to toss anything into and go! Wish I would have done this sooner to use as a pool or beach bag but for now, baby essentials will get stowed in it! Here is what I did:

1.) Trim off with scissors the sleeves, neckline, and bottom of the T at the seams. I like to make the neckline into a V-cut, it looks better once the bag is done.




2.) Next, cut 5'' strips up the bottom of the T all the way across the bottom about a rulers width apart. Be sure to snip the side seam to get open strips.




3.) Now, hold the T with one hand on the table and pull down on each strip to stretch them out so they coil up.


4.) Lastly, tie double square knots all along the bottom of the T with the strips you made. I start on one side and go half way, then switch to the opposite side to finish it out.




5.) And, waa-laa!!! You have your T-Shirt Bag!! I'm sure there are endless possibilities with this patten and any shirt. Have fun!
